I've completed the game. For the most part, everything feels exactly like Budokai 3. The "Drama Pieces" are merely substitutes for the capsules in previous games. They give you various effects (Faster Ki charges, Character Supports, Minor Health Increases, etc.,) in the form of cutscenes in the middle of fights. The "Blow Away Attacks" replace the "Dragon Rush" from the 3rd game, where you have to mash buttons to win. The character models are smooth and clean. They animate quite perfectly as well.

The levels often "blur" when the characters are moving at high speeds, so that can often be a distraction on the eyes. The controls for the X360 version are a bit iffy. Movement feels a bit off, so more often that I see most XBL users spamming Ki blasts throughout the whole fight. Unfortunately, that's all it takes to win and increases Battle Points.
